Beijing Ancient Observatory

Another pride of China is Beijing Ancient Observatory, which is a pre-telescopic observatory built in 1442. Can you imagine that? This tourist site is very famous for its historical background – the Beijing Ancient Observatory shows the technological advancement in China from the past. It’s one of the oldest observatories in the whole world. It was constructed during the Ming dynasty. Leshan Giant Buddha

One common thing you will be able to find all over China is Buddha. You should try your best to visit this UNESCO world heritage site in China, which was built in 713 AD. Leshan Giant Buddha is 71 meters tall and was built by a Buddhist monk. Don’t miss exploring the world’s largest Buddha structure. You will be amazed at the sculpture. Leshan Giant Buddha is carved out of a mountain – the red bed sandstone. Right beside Leshan Giant Buddha, the Min River and Dado River flows to Southern China.
